61 Buckingham Drive is a 67 m² / 721 sq ft terraced home in Loughborough. It sold for £217,500 in November 2022. Indexed forward to today's value, that sale is roughly £218k. Recent local prices imply a broad valuation context of £166k to £226k based on its internal area. The Land Registry and EPC data was last updated 1 June 2026.
